How Smart Garage Door Openers Work

Smart garage door technology isn't magic. It's a retrofit device or a modern opener that connects to your wifi network and communicates with your smartphone. Most systems use a small hub that installs inside your garage, paired with sensors on the door itself. Once connected, you get live status updates, remote operation, and automation rules.

The app shows whether your door is open or closed in real time. If someone opens it while you're at work, you get an instant notification. You can close it remotely, schedule automatic closing at sunset, or grant temporary access to contractors and family members. Some systems integrate with Alexa, Google Home, and other smart home platforms, so you can control your door with voice commands.

Popular Smart Garage Door Systems

Several brands dominate the market. Meross, Liftmaster, Genie, and Chamberlain all offer reliable wifi-enabled models. Each has different app interfaces, automation features, and price points. Meross tends toward the budget-friendly end. Liftmaster and Genie focus on robust, commercial-grade reliability. Chamberlain sits in the middle and plays well with other smart home devices.

Smart Garage Door Features Worth Having

When you're shopping for a system, look for these features. Real time status updates matter more than you'd think. Two way audio lets you communicate with someone outside your garage. Activity logs create a record of who opened or closed the door and when. Geofencing automatically opens your door as you approach home and closes it when everyone leaves. Integration with major smart home platforms ensures it plays nicely with your other devices.

Installation and Support

Smart garage door systems require a reliable wifi connection. If your garage is far from your router, you may need a wifi extender. Installation includes mounting the hub, calibrating the sensors, and configuring your app settings. We handle all of that during the same-day appointment.

Once installed, these systems rarely need attention. Batteries in the sensors typically last 2 to 3 years. Firmware updates happen automatically. If issues arise, we troubleshoot remotely or visit your home to diagnose the problem.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I add smart technology to my existing garage door opener? Yes. Retrofit kits install over your current opener and add wifi connectivity and app control without replacing the entire unit. Most retrofits take under two hours and cost less than a full opener replacement.

What happens if my wifi goes down? Your garage door opener reverts to manual operation. You can still use the wall button and remote control inside the garage. The app won't work until your internet is restored, but the door itself functions normally.

Do smart garage door systems work with my phone if I'm out of state? Absolutely. As long as your garage hub has internet access and your phone has cellular or wifi, you can monitor and control your door from anywhere in the world. Notifications arrive instantly.

How secure is the app? Can hackers open my garage? Reputable brands use encryption and two factor authentication. Your garage door app is as secure as any other connected device. We recommend using a strong password and enabling all available security features in the app settings.

Will a smart garage door opener work with my existing safety features? Yes. Smart openers include auto reverse and photo eye sensors just like standard models. They add connectivity and automation on top of existing safety standards. Your door remains just as safe, with added convenience.
